Charly Nix could lose everything when her rustic Alabama retreat is rocked by a missing persons scandal. When Colby agent Billie Jagger arrives to help Charly search for the newlywed couple who have disappeared, the stakes intensify when he reveals that it’s his beloved sister who’s missing. And he’ll stop at nothing to find her. But as he and Charly investigate, their solo MOs develop into a partnership with feelings neither expected. Most alarming, the couple’s disappearance may be related to decades of other unsolved crimes in the quiet small town. Can they rescue Briana and Martin—before they’re gone for good?

AudioBook Review: The Missing Couple by Debra Webb
The Missing Couple is another engaging mystery in Debra Webb’s Colby Agency series. While the books are connected through the Colby Agency, each story stands on its own, making them easy to read in any order. I’ve really enjoyed every installment I’ve read, and this one was no exception.
One of my favorite characters was Charlie. Thanks to the skills she learned from her father—a former sheriff and expert tracker—she plays an important role in the investigation with her remarkable ability to track people through the woods. I always enjoy seeing characters contribute unique talents to a case, and Charlie’s expertise added an extra layer of authenticity to the story.
Billy, the Colby Agency investigator assigned to the case, was another standout character. His involvement is personal because the missing couple includes his sister and her new husband, which raises the emotional stakes and makes the investigation even more compelling. (I have to admit, it took me a little while to get used to a hero named Billy! 😊)
As with many of Debra Webb’s novels, the suspense builds steadily as new clues and suspects emerge. The story is a good reminder that even the quietest small towns can hide dangerous secrets beneath the surface.
If you enjoy fast-paced mysteries, likable investigators, and romantic suspense with plenty of twists, The Missing Couple is another solid addition to the Colby Agency series.
